Aluminum roof waterproofing services involve applying a specialized coating or membrane made from aluminum to the surface of a roof. This process creates a protective barrier that prevents water from seeping through the roofing material, helping to keep the interior of a property dry and secure. The application typically includes cleaning the roof surface, inspecting for any damage or weak spots, and then installing the aluminum coating or panels to ensure a seamless, durable seal. This type of waterproofing is designed to withstand exposure to rain, snow, and other weather elements, extending the life of the roof and reducing the risk of leaks.
One of the primary problems aluminum roof waterproofing addresses is water infiltration, which can lead to significant damage over time. Leaks can cause mold growth, wood rot, and structural deterioration if not properly managed. Aluminum coatings are highly resistant to corrosion and can adapt to temperature changes, making them an effective solution for preventing water from penetrating the roof. Additionally, this service helps mitigate issues caused by aging roofing materials, such as cracking or blistering, which can compromise the roof’s integrity. Property owners who notice signs of moisture or water stains inside their building may find aluminum waterproofing to be a practical repair option.

The overview below groups typical Aluminum Roof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sheboygan,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ine aluminum roof waterproofing repairs in Sheboygan range from $250 to $600. Many small jobs fall within this range, covering patching leaks or sealing minor cracks. Larger or more complex repairs may cost more depending on the extent of work needed.
Partial Roof Coatings - Applying waterproof coatings to sections of an aluminum roof us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ects in this category stay within this range, with costs increasing for larger surface areas or special coating materials.
Full Roof Coating - Complete waterproof coating for an entire aluminum roof typically ranges from $3,500 to $8,000. Many full-coverage projects are priced in this band, though larger or more intricate roofs can push costs higher.
Full Roof Replacement - Replacing an aluminum roof with waterproofing features generally costs $10,000 to $20,000 or more. While most projects fall into this higher range, some smaller or less complex replacements may be priced lower depending on size and materials used.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
